What is anxiety and how to get rid of it

It is absolutely normal to experience anxiety from time to time, as well as to experience other emotions: fear, anger, sadness. Even increased anxiety does not always mean there is a problem. It can be a character trait that does not interfere with a person and his loved ones (1).

But if anxiety occurs frequently or for no apparent reason, it causes discomfort and deteriorates the quality of life. People with anxiety disorders often experience intense worry and fear about seemingly normal situations. Sometimes anxiety provokes panic attacks, which are important to learn to cope with.

Signs and symptoms of anxiety

These symptoms will help you recognize increased anxiety:

  • feeling of anxiety, nervousness;
  • fast fatiguability;
  • difficulty concentrating;
  • irritability;
  • headaches, muscle pain or abdominal pain;
  • sleep problems.

Hypercontrol: recognize and destroy

Anxiety can develop into overcontrol. This is the need to constantly monitor events occurring in your personal life or the lives of loved ones. This behavior provides a temporary feeling of security and alleviates feelings of intense anxiety.

But changes such as moving, changing jobs, or meeting new people are quite difficult for people with hypercontrol. The same goes for improving your personal life: there is a constant need to know where your partner is, what he is doing or what he is thinking about.

Sometimes the desire to control everything and attempts to protect yourself and others from possible risks looks strange. The emotional state and increased control are often influenced by a continuous flow of news, doomscrolling, as well as constant monitoring of social networks. The cause of overcontrolling behavior can be traumatic events of the past: stress associated with the illness of loved ones, emergencies and car accidents.

Anxiety disorders are treated with psychotherapy and medications. The doctor selects the required regimen. As self-help, psychologists advise practicing stress management methods: special exercises, mindfulness and meditation. All of them reduce symptoms of anxiety.
